实现"mysql-8.0.xx-linux-glibc2.12-x86_64.tar.gz"的步骤
作为一名经验丰富的开发者,我将向你展示如何实现"mysql-8.0.xx-linux-glibc2.12-x86_64.tar.gz"的过程。下面是整个过程的步骤概览:
步骤 | 操作 |
---|---|
1. | 下载MySQL安装包 |
2. | 解压MySQL安装包 |
3. | 配置MySQL |
4. | 启动MySQL服务 |
5. | 设置MySQL的root账户密码 |
6. | 连接MySQL数据库 |
现在,我将逐步指导你完成每个步骤,告诉你需要做什么以及相应的代码。
步骤 1:下载MySQL安装包
首先,你需要下载MySQL的安装包。你可以从MySQL官方网站下载最新版本的tar.gz文件。假设你已经在你的Linux系统上创建了一个用于存储安装包的文件夹,比如/home/user/mysql
。在命令行中使用以下代码下载安装包:
cd /home/user/mysql
wget
请将上述代码中的8.0.xx
替换为实际的版本号。
步骤 2:解压MySQL安装包
下载完成后,你需要解压MySQL的安装包。使用以下命令解压:
tar -xvf mysql-8.0.xx-linux-glibc2.12-x86_64.tar.gz
步骤 3:配置MySQL
解压完成后,进入解压后的目录,使用以下命令进行MySQL的配置:
cd mysql-8.0.xx-linux-glibc2.12-x86_64
sudo groupadd mysql
sudo useradd -r -g mysql -s /bin/false mysql
sudo mkdir /usr/local/mysql
sudo chown -R mysql:mysql /usr/local/mysql
sudo bin/mysqld --initialize --user=mysql --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data
sudo cp support-files/mysql.server /etc/init.d/mysql.server
sudo chmod +x /etc/init.d/mysql.server
上述代码中,--initialize
选项将初始化MySQL实例,--basedir
选项指定了MySQL的安装目录,--datadir
选项指定了MySQL数据文件的存放目录。
步骤 4:启动MySQL服务
配置完成后,你可以启动MySQL服务。使用以下命令启动:
sudo service mysql.server start
步骤 5:设置MySQL的root账户密码
在启动MySQL服务后,你需要设置root账户的密码。使用以下命令:
sudo bin/mysqladmin -u root password 'new_password'
请将上述代码中的new_password
替换为你想要设置的root账户密码。
步骤 6:连接MySQL数据库
现在,你可以使用以下命令连接到MySQL数据库:
/usr/local/mysql/bin/mysql -u root -p
系统将提示你输入root账户的密码,请输入之前设置的密码。连接成功后,你将进入MySQL的命令行界面。
恭喜!你已经成功实现了"mysql-8.0.xx-linux-glibc2.12-x86_64.tar.gz"的安装和配置。
希望这篇文章对你有所帮助!如果你有任何疑问,请随时提问。